The hotel

This sleek, imposing hotel offers the high standards you would expect of a Hyatt. It lies right on Union Square, in the centre of the city and in one of the best spots for shopping. Public transport is an easy walk, too. OneUP - exactly one level up from the lobby is the inventive American Bistro and Lounge. Serving breakfast, lunch and dinner, the OneUP restaurant features locally sourced, sustainable American cuisine. The bridge, connects the restaurant to the Lounge.

Hotel information

668 rooms on 36 floors in 1 building. All with air-conditioning, cable TV with pay-per-view films, hairdryer, iron and board. Standard Rooms sleep maximum 4 adults.

OneUP Restaurant (American bistro serving breakfast, lunch and dinner) and OneUP Lounge (cocktails and appetisers), Coffee Bar (serving breakfast items, snacks and drinks). Complimentary Hyatt StayFit® on 35th floor. Room service*. Laundry/dry-cleaning service*. Complimentary WiFi. Safe available at front desk*. Self-parking $41, valet parking $74.10 plus tax, per day (payable locally, subject to change).

*Denotes local charge.

Please note: 100% non smoking hotel.

Please note:  Effective 1st January 2021 the hotel will be introducting a destination fee payable locally of $30 per night plus tax subject to change.

Checked into the hotel. Immediately noticed the view of city from the room was amazing. I liked the location being down town. The AC and bed were also nice. First night had some issues but the managers and handyman were able to fix the issues. The first half of my stay was decent except some nights there was a loud creaking from I don't know where that made falling asleep difficult. And then the workers strike began. From waking up to falling asleep I could hear the strikers outside chanting and banging on pots, and if I could hear them more than 20 floors up pretty much the whole building could hear them. When walking in and out of the hotel would be accosted by the sheer amount of noise and the strikers shouting "Why are you staying here?!" and "You should check out!". Did my best to only be in the hotel when sleeping. Next time in San Francisco, not sure I would stay here again. Read less

Luxury Hotel Turned Nightmare Due to Strike What should have been a luxurious stay at the Grand Hyatt turned into an absolutely frustrating experience due to the ongoing employee strike. I understand workers' rights to protest, but management's handling of the situation was abysmal and guests were left to suffer the consequences. From the moment I arrived, it was clear this wasn't the five-star experience I had paid for. The entrance was crowded with striking workers, making it awkward and uncomfortable to enter. Without the regular bell staff, I had to drag my own luggage through the chaos. The check-in process took nearly an hour due to skeletal staffing at the front desk. The room itself showed clear signs of neglected maintenance. Trash hadn't been properly removed from the previous guest, the sheets appeared unchanged, and dust was visible on most surfaces. Calls to housekeeping went unanswered, and when I went to the front desk to complain, I was told they were "operating with limited staff" and would "get to it when possible." They never did. The restaurants were moved to higher floors, which was not nice. Room service was non-existent. What's most frustrating is the hotel's complete lack of transparency. At these prices ($400+ per night), they should have warned guests about the strike situation before arrival or offered cancellations without penalty. Instead, they seemed content to collect full rates while delivering motel-level service. The few replacement workers they did have appeared undertrained and overwhelmed. Simple requests like extra towels or working WiFi passwords turned into ordeals. Pro tip: If you're considering booking the Grand Hyatt, check if the strike is still ongoing. If it is, save yourself the headache and book elsewhere. This was possibly the worst value for money I've ever experienced at a supposedly luxury hotel. Positives: - Location is still good - Building's architecture is nice from the outside Negatives: - Severely understaffed - Poor communication about strike situation - Neglected cleanliness - Closed amenities - Inadequate compensation for subpar experience - Overpriced for the level of service provided - Replacement staff poorly trained - No proper dining options - Unresponsive management - Uncomfortable arrival experience Would not recommend until the strike is resolved and regular operations resume.
